The Secure Project Lifecycle process has been established to perform risk assessments, ensuring security is considered as part of the design and throughout the project lifecycle. The SPL process governs projects within the Planview time recording and management system and those that are managed outside such as Move to the Cloud (MttC) programme.
The role will be to augment the Information Security team to perform risk assessments of projects, provide guidance and acquire outcomes/decisions from the project manager, enterprise architect, technical architect, solutions architect, data privacy officer, project management office, strategic change development, IT Infrastructure and Operations and penetration testers.
The specialist will work under the responsibility of the Head of IS Services and Risk Management and will report to the Secure Project Lifecycle Team Lead. The responsibilities of the role will include the following:
- Review submission of IS Criticality Assessment (ISCA) questionnaire (ISCA Dashboard)
- Determine high level security requirements and project criticality, based on standard project activities and data classification from DP pre-screening
- Work with assigned architect to ensure security requirements are finalized in design (High Level Design), review with Enterprise Architecture, Solutions Architecture, Cyber Security and Cyber Assurance
- Review of all security requirements and evidence provided by the project manager to support closure of each requirement:
- Review and feedback on ISCA questionnaire
- Review and feedback on High Level Design (HLD)
- Present at ISCA Project Technical Review
- Attend and obtain HLD sign-off at Technical Design Authority, Solutions Design Authority (SDA) and Data Intelligence and Analytics (DIA)
- Obtain Third Party Risk Evaluation Platform (TPREP) scorecard for TP SaaS solutions from Security Contracts team
- Obtain Minimum Technical Security Baseline compliance reporting from QualysGuard
- Obtain Cloud Permit from Enterprise Architecture
- Obtain Code Review and Analysis – in house solutions only from SCD
- Self-serve vulnerability assessment compliance report of assets in scope
- Liaise with Cyber Assurance on penetration testing of solution and obtain sign off
- Obtain Digital Hub registration for external facing solutions from Cyber Assurance
- Produce Project Security Assessment closure report
- Perform a final review of all open security requirements and their status before any stage gate approval can be provided (effectively the Production Go/No-go decision).
- Ensure AXA XL SDLC agile, waterfall and infra waterfall processes are followed
- Store all evidence in IS projects shared area
- Update the project register daily to ensure project status is maintained and update the Project Security Assessment (PSA) template as a record of activity. Submit PSA for sign off to complete risk assessment
- Manage project RAG status ensuring activities trending amber and red are highlighted to management and the project manager
- Liaise with project manager to support the development of the risk acceptance (PM is responsible) where needed
- Attend meetings with project manager, stakeholders, ISCA technical review, architectural design authorities and pen testing reviews. Challenge design decisions not compliant with security, escalate issues when they become known, offer options to resolve
